Compliance context

AB 802 (Public Resources Code §25402.10)

AB 802 requires every California commercial building over 50,000 sq ft to report energy use to the CEC annually; the CEC publicly discloses the results statewide.

Frequently asked questions

What is Meadowview Service Center's energy grade?

Meadowview Service Center did not report an ENERGY STAR score in its 2024 disclosure, but its site energy-use intensity was 75.1 kBtu/ft².

How much energy does Meadowview Service Center use?

Its 2024 site energy-use intensity was 75.1 kBtu/ft² across 122,071 sq ft, including 622,743 kWh of electricity and 42,941 therms of natural gas.

What are Meadowview Service Center's carbon emissions?

Meadowview Service Center reported 369 tCO₂e of greenhouse-gas emissions (3.0 kgCO₂e/ft²) for 2024. AB 802 requires every California commercial building over 50,000 sq ft to report energy use to the CEC annually; the CEC publicly discloses the results statewide.
